What is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day?

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day is a high-quality, comprehensive multivitamin and mineral supplement designed to provide foundational nutritional support in a convenient two-capsule-per-day format. The formula is packed with highly bioavailable nutrients, meaning the body can absorb and utilize them more efficiently compared to some other formulations. This supplement is popular among those seeking to fill dietary gaps and support overall health, including heart, brain, immune, and bone health. Its clean formula is also NSF Certified for Sport®, ensuring it is free from contaminants and banned substances for athletes. The primary feature is its simple and effective twice-daily dosing schedule, which is key to maximizing its benefits.

The Recommended Protocol: Two Capsules Daily

While the product name may seem to suggest a different frequency, the core instruction is to take two capsules daily. A single bottle containing 60 capsules is designed to be a 30-day supply. The optimal timing and method for taking these two capsules, however, depends on personal preference and how your body responds.

The Standard Split-Dose Schedule

For most individuals, the most effective method is to split the daily dose into one capsule in the morning and one in the evening. The typical recommendation is to take one capsule with breakfast and the second capsule with dinner.

Benefits of Splitting the Dose:

  • Improved Absorption of Water-Soluble Vitamins: Water-soluble vitamins like the B vitamins and Vitamin C cannot be stored by the body and are excreted if not used. Spreading them out over two meals ensures a more consistent supply throughout the day, rather than overwhelming the body with a single dose.
  • Reduced Risk of Nausea or Digestive Upset: Some individuals experience mild nausea or stomach discomfort when taking multivitamins, especially high-potency ones, on an empty stomach or all at once. Splitting the dose and taking it with food can significantly mitigate this issue by dispersing the nutrients into a larger mass of food.
  • Sustained Energy: B vitamins can have an energizing effect on some people. Taking a dose in the morning can provide a boost for the day, while spacing out the intake prevents a large rush of energy that could interfere with sleep if taken later.

The Single-Dose Option

For those who prefer a simpler routine, taking both capsules at once is an option, as long as it's with a substantial meal. This method relies on the meal to aid absorption and prevent stomach upset.

Considerations for a Single Dose:

  • Meal Size: A full meal is necessary to help disperse the nutrients and ensure proper digestion. Taking both capsules with a light snack is not advisable.
  • Consistency: The biggest advantage is the ease of remembering. If taking supplements twice a day is a struggle, a single-dose approach with a large meal like breakfast or lunch might be more sustainable for long-term consistency.
  • Energy Levels: If you find the B vitamins in the multivitamin particularly energizing, taking both capsules later in the day could potentially impact your sleep.

Taking with Food: The Golden Rule

Regardless of whether you split the dose or take it all at once, taking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day with a meal is the most important rule. Here's why:

  • Fat-Soluble Vitamin Absorption: Vitamins A, D, E, and K are fat-soluble, meaning they require dietary fat for optimal absorption. Taking your multivitamin with a meal containing some fat ensures these critical vitamins are properly assimilated by the body.
  • Preventing Nausea: As mentioned, taking a potent multivitamin on an empty stomach can lead to an upset stomach. The food acts as a buffer and helps prevent this side effect.
  • Mimicking Natural Nutrient Intake: Supplements are meant to supplement a healthy diet, not replace it. Taking them with food helps to mimic how your body naturally receives nutrients from food, facilitating better utilization.

Comparison: Basic Nutrients 2/Day vs. Multi-Vitamin Elite AM/PM

It is helpful to contrast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day with another product like the Multi-Vitamin Elite AM/PM to understand why the dosing is different and when to choose each option. The choice depends on your specific health goals and activity level.

Feature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day Thorne Multi-Vitamin Elite AM/PM
Dosage 2 capsules daily 3 AM capsules and 3 PM capsules daily
Timing Split dose (morning/evening) or single dose, both with meals AM dose with morning meal, PM dose with evening meal
Target User General foundational health and wellness Active individuals, athletes, and those with high-performance nutritional demands
Formula Comprehensive blend of bioavailable vitamins and minerals Targeted formulas with added ingredients like Meriva, green tea (AM), and Relora (PM) for energy and recovery
Primary Goal Fill common dietary gaps in essential nutrients Optimize nutritional support for performance and recovery throughout the day and night

Consistency is Key for Maximum Benefit

Beyond the specific timing, consistency is perhaps the most important factor in a successful supplementation routine. Taking your multivitamin regularly helps maintain steady nutrient levels in the body, providing reliable foundational support for your health goals. Finding a schedule that you can stick to, whether it's a split dose or a single dose, is what will ultimately produce the best results over time.

Conclusion

For Thorne Basic Nutrients 2/Day, the optimal approach is to take two capsules daily, ideally split into one capsule with breakfast and one with dinner to maximize absorption and minimize digestive discomfort. The single-dose method is a viable alternative for those who prioritize convenience, as long as it is taken with a full meal. Ultimately, the key is to choose a schedule that you can consistently follow, always pairing your supplement with food and consulting with a healthcare professional to ensure it aligns with your specific health needs.
